Перенаправление Google OAuth в Google вместо возврата обратно в приложение (React Native/NodeJS)Android

Форум для тех, кто программирует под Android
Ответить
Anonymous
 Перенаправление Google OAuth в Google вместо возврата обратно в приложение (React Native/NodeJS)

Сообщение Anonymous »

Если бы кто-нибудь мог мне помочь с этим, я был бы очень благодарен.
Я успешно внедрил GoogleOAuth для Интернета (без паспорта или googlepais). Я использовал это видео в качестве ссылки:
Сейчас я пытаюсь реализовать его для Android, и вот где я застрял. Тестируя в своем эмуляторе, я могу перейти из своего приложения в веб-браузер, где вижу (как и ожидалось) экран согласия Google. Проблема в том, что после команды «Продолжить» Экран согласия Google пытается перенаправить обратно в мое приложение, но всегда терпит неудачу и перенаправляет в Google.
Я нужна помощь, как перейти из веб-браузера обратно в мое приложение в эмуляторе Android.
Я ввел отпечаток сертификата SHA-1 и имя пакета для идентификатора клиента. для Android в консоли Google. Я думаю, что моя проблема в моем коде. Я думаю, что проблемы связаны с моим Uri перенаправления Android и текущей настройкой моего AndroidManifest.xml.
Мой Uri перенаправления Android: com.googleusercontent.apps.client-id-here:/authorizeLogin
authorizeLogin — моя функция, которая обрабатывает логику. Я также приложил фотографию моего AndroidManifest.xml. Правильно ли это думать о том, в чем проблема? Может кто-нибудь подтвердить или опровергнуть? Если это так, какой синтаксис мне не хватает? Как я уже сказал, любые рекомендации или помощь будут оценены по достоинству. При необходимости я могу предоставить больше своего кода, но я хотел быть осторожным, поскольку он имеет дело со многими моими переменными env, которые должны оставаться в секрете.
Изображение


Подробнее здесь: https://stackoverflow.com/questions/783 ... -app-react
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»